Analysis of Documentation of Real Damage to Vehicles in Road Accidents
Novotný, Václav ; Kovanda,, Jan (referee) ; Vémola, Aleš (advisor)
This diploma thesis deals with a comprehensive analysis of the photographic documentation of vehicle damage in traffic accidents. A systematic overview of the current documentation and included inspection is carried out in the analysis. Police records are compared with records made during the crash tests. Further, the documentation in this thesis is divided into two groups of conflicts. The representative of the accidents are described in detail and then evaluated. Similarly, this procedure is practiced on other car accident that reflect the mutual deformation. The result of this thesis is to determine the optimal location of the lens for the acquisition of documentation and establishing a baseline number of photos to document damage to the vehicle after the traffic accident.
Manufacturing of wheel holder for washing machine
Kopřiva, Tomáš ; Císařová, Michaela (referee) ; Podaný, Kamil (advisor)
The project is design technology components by cutting and bending. It is a component, which is used for attaching wheel of waching machine.It is manufactured from sheet steel. Analysis of suitable technologies for the production of manufacturing were selected in the combined processing tools. The tool uses standard components for cutting and bending, which is done on an eccentric press LEN 40 (manufacturer ŠMERAL Brno), with a nominal tensile force 400 kN. The prize of holder is about 8 Kč.
Stress, deformation and reliability computational analysis of the adjustable tandem trike frame
Ščotka, Martin ; Kubík, Petr (referee) ; Vrbka, Jan (advisor)
This bachelor thesis deals with stress, deformation and safety analyses of adjustable frame of tandem tricycle. Starting with brief introduction of cycling, especially alternative cycling followed by indicating of whip assumptions and computational model of the frame. The final calculations have been done in three basic modes: direct motion, braking and cornering. Inner Stress Resultant has been summed, reduced pressure in a dangerous point has been expressed and safety issue has been figured up as well. Mathematical software MAPLE has been used to solve the assignment. Model is provided in software Autodesk Inventor
Design of excavation in the Brno city centre
Kováč, Vladimír ; Miča, Lumír (referee) ; Chalmovský, Juraj (advisor)
The work deals with the problem of the ultimate and serviceability limit state of a once-anchored retaining structure of an excavation on Krenova street in Brno. The calculation of the ultimate limit state is solved manually and provides an input into the serviceability limit state, which is solved by means of a numerical analysis using a finite element method. To calculate the serviceability limit state, these constitutive models: Mohr-Columb, Hardening soil and Hardening soil small strain model are used.

Measurement of Chassis Torsion Stiffness with Use of Optical System TRITOP
Derner, Petr ; Svárovský, Pavel (referee) ; Porteš, Petr (advisor)
This master's thesis deals with measurement of torsional rigidity of a vehicle body with the application of TRITOP optical measuring system. The measurement was made in dynamic test-room of Škoda Auto a.s. together with a methodology used by this company. In the light of the objective comparison of both measuring methods and their accuracy, the optimal method of measurment and evaluation was made.
Deformation, stress and safety analysis of the recumbend frame.
Verner, Jan ; Majer, Zdeněk (referee) ; Vrbka, Jan (advisor)
This work contains deformation, stress and safety analysis of recumbent bike frame from company AZUB. After introduction about history, definition of beam and beam assumptions, computational model of the frame was made fallowed the main solution. Three load states was checked - stillnes / uniform ride, deceleration and pedalling. The third one was subjected to deeper analysis. Bending problem in defined location was solved for all states. Inner stress resultans was solved as Von Misses stress, and the safet y was calculated. The fist state was compared with FEM. A program in MATLAB was made, enabeling calculation of user- selected frame geometry and loading.

Assessment of characteristic of a helical conus-shaped spring under compression
Loveček, Libor ; Žák, Stanislav (referee) ; Burša, Jiří (advisor)
The presented bachelor thesis pursue the behaviour of coiled conical pressure spring while loaded. Thesis includes analytical calculation in accordace to the slighty curvatured rod theory. Calculation is designed for a specific coiled conical spring in a MAPLE environment. The results are compared with data acquired while experimenting with the spring.
